Output e8398d5b974dea1b38a7dbd03004608a993676eb497b7ae9788f8d5070a66851:59

value
18714550
script pubkey
OP_0 OP_PUSHBYTES_32 4f6eb46c1bce34485e1a6644f212c21853c446ae5304932639a568b6c3ab7143
address
bc1qfahtgmqmec6yshs6vez0yykzrpfug34w2vzfxf3e545tdsatw9psq3gxl4
transaction
e8398d5b974dea1b38a7dbd03004608a993676eb497b7ae9788f8d5070a66851